摘要
Pressure effects on 1H chemical shifts and relaxation rates in organic solvents containing the nitroxide radical have been observed. 1H chemical shifts with pressure and pressure-broadenings for hydrogen bonding between proton-donor molecules and the nitroxide radical have been observed. © 1979.
